Synopsis
With his latest film "Head On" about to hit screens across the country, actor Vince Chase is living the player's life in L.A. Along for the ride are his best friends (and now employees): Eric and Turtle, who grew up with him in Queens, and Vince's brother, Johnny Drama. The crew spends most of their time relaxing at Vince's house in the Hollywood hills, shooting hoops, playing rooftop golf and entertaining ladies at the pool.
But to keep the lifestyle going, Vince has to keep making movies, and his superagent Ari thinks he's found just the project--the action film "Matterhorn." "Too busy" to read the script himself, Vince presses Eric, the only person he really trusts, for his honest appraisal, and his friend gives the "Die Hard at Disneyland" concept a thumbs down.
Ari goes ballistic when he hears that someone has gotten the ear of his client, and unleashes a torrent of abuse at the neophyte Eric over a sushi power dinner. Later, Ari calls with the capper: while Vince was dragging his feet on "Matterhorn," Colin Farrell has taken the part, keeping everyone from a multimillion-dollar payday.
